Reimagining Play Infrastructure: The Future of Interactive Outdoor Spaces

As urban environments evolve under the pressures of population growth, environmental sustainability, and technological innovation, the *public* and *private* sectors alike are redefining the concept of recreational spaces. Traditional playgrounds—once solely constructed from wood and plastic—are giving way to dynamic, interactive environments that foster not only physical activity but also digital engagement and social connectivity.

Innovations in Outdoor Play: A Digital Renaissance

Recent years have seen a surge of innovation aimed at transforming outdoor recreation areas into vibrant hubs of learning, health, and community interaction. Central to these developments is the integration of multimedia, sensory elements, and adaptable play equipment. Industry leaders and urban planners are increasingly leveraging technology to craft experiences that are both engaging and inclusive.

Aspect of Play Space Traditional Approach Emerging Interactive Innovations
Play Equipment Materials Wood, plastic, metal Smart materials with sensors, durable sustainable composites
Design Focus Physical activity, simple entertainment Physical + cognitive development, social interaction
Connectivity Offline, standalone devices Wi-Fi enabled, augmented reality features

Positioning for the Future: Challenges and Opportunities

While innovations like “Wheel Out play” provide compelling advantages, they also pose challenges—such as ensuring long-term durability, data privacy, and equitable access. Industry stakeholders must collaborate to develop standardized safety protocols and inclusive design practices.

Looking ahead, integrating intelligent sensors and data analytics will allow for real-time monitoring of play activity, informing urban managers on usage patterns, wear-and-tear, and safety concerns. This ongoing evolution will foster more resilient and community-responsive outdoor environments.
